For an oil change, since we don't have a dipstick. they can't just let the car sit. They drive around so the oil warms up then measure it while it's at operating temp, then drive back.
You cannot measure it when it's cold, and you shouldn't let it sit (As the manual states, you should warm the car up while driving).
As we all know, it goes take a good 8-12 miles to get the oil up to operating temp, and they would need to drive those same miles back.
So 22 miles seems fine IMO
